Mission travel agency's People Tracker software helps spur its growth
Within minutes of the news Thursday that a jetliner had splashed down in the Hudson River, a Mission travel agency was sending e-mail alerts to clients and others that their employees and loved ones weren't aboard.
Thanks to All About Travel's proprietary “People Tracker” data system, it knew that none of the 155 passengers on US Airways Flight 1549 were among the agency's 358 clients using that airline that day.
Company president Brent Blake said the unique technology was not for sale. “That's the value we can provide in today's world,” Blake said. “It's really fueled our growth.” The company has melded off–the–shelf software with real–time airline data available to all travel agencies into what he says is state–of–the–art technology that flags travelers, tracks their movements and flight changes, alerts them to impending dangers such as hurricanes or civil unrest, and helps extract them in a hurry from crisis locations.
